Kinds Of Paint Finishes
When it comes to repaint coatings, there are five primary kinds you should know about: flat, eggshell, satin, semi-gloss, and gloss. Each type offers a certain purpose and can significantly impact the look of your space.
Level coatings have a matte look, making them fantastic for hiding flaws on walls. They're perfect for ceilings or low-traffic locations yet can be challenging to tidy.
Eggshell finishes provide a mild luster, supplying even more resilience while still being forgiving on imperfections. They're perfect for living rooms or rooms.

Picking the Right End Up
Choosing the appropriate paint surface can be a game changer in your house's aesthetic and performance. To make professional apartment painters , take into consideration the area's objective and the level of durability you require.
For high-traffic locations like hallways or kitchens, go with a satin or semi-gloss surface; these are more resistant to spots and easy to clean.
If you're repainting a bed room or a living room, a flat or eggshell surface might be the way to go. These coatings give a softer look and can hide blemishes well, developing a relaxing environment.
Do not forget about lights, either. Glossy surfaces can reflect light, making a tiny space really feel larger, while matte surfaces soak up light, adding warmth.
Finally, think about maintenance. Glossy surfaces require more regular upkeep to preserve their luster, while matte finishes may need touch-ups more frequently because of scuffs.
